quote:

WAR is a good metric, but there are other ways/metrics to determine a player's value.

WAR is good at placing players in tiers. Its not good as a black and white stat

What does that mean? It means its a pretty reliable stat at telling you someone worth 4 wins is better than someone worth 3. However, it cant tell you with much confidence that a 4.5 player is worth more than a 4.3

So yes and no. Its good at putting players in tiers. Its not good as a black and white list
